Buckner Retirement Services Community: Buckner VillasLocation: Austin, TX - Onsite Address: 11110 Tom Adams Dr, Austin, TX 78753Job Status: Full TimeWe are seeking a Executive Director to join our community committed to delivering outstanding service to our staff, residents, and families. As a Executive Director you will play an important role in providing inspiring leadership and supervision to the senior living community and programs, including, but not limited to, compliance with related contract and regulatory standards, and alignment with Buckner’s mission, vision and values. Coordinate and oversee the overall strategy, budget development and performance of the community. Responsible for planning, implementing and coordinating comprehensive programs to meet business operational goals and further the mission of Buckner. In addition, this position will ensure the delivery of effective, safe, and appropriate quality care to clients in accordance with Federal, State and local laws, regulations and guidelines as well as Buckner’s mission, policies, and procedures. Oversee all regulatory compliance for the assigned facility and ensure a safe environment is provided for all clients and staff. Set the tone for the community’s vibrant, engaging lifestyle and help both residents and staff members experience “life opened wide” through a fun, dynamic approach to everyday living.
